Women who genuinely enjoy your careers: what do you do and what does the future look like in your field? by Fight_For_Your_Dream in AskWomen

[–]oneofmooseyness 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Union commercial/ industrial electrician! I was bartending and trying to figure out a career for myself in my mid-20s when I met a female electrician. I thought she was basically the coolest chick I had ever met, with the coolest job! I was like how do I get in to that? She told me to apply at the union hall, and after a 5 year apprenticeship I became a licensed, Journeyman electrician. 10/10 experience, and i make really good money. Plus, I have so much fun building things all day! Absolutely loved Lego and stuff as a kid, so meticulous projects with lengthy instructions are right up my alley. I also really love most of the people I've met in the electrician union and consider them my good friends 🧡 The future outlook of our work is bright, as long as women are still allowed to have jobs 🤣

[deleted by user] by [deleted] in GothFashion

[–]oneofmooseyness 6 points7 points  (0 children)

Dental floss is used by alt ppl to sew patches onto clothes because it's cheap and tough
